The Curious Case of Benjamin Button is a short story by F. Scott Fitzgerald. The story follows Benjamin's life from his birth. However he is no ordinary child, as he has the appearance of a 70 year old man, already capable of speech. His family soon realizes that Benjamin is aging in reverse, becoming younger as the years go by.
The fascinating story looks at his triumphs and struggles as he slowly gains his youth. Adding in themes of love and acceptance, F. Scott Fitzgerald details the difficulties and feelings of not fitting into ones designated age group in an entertaining and insightful manor.

F Scott Fitzgerald
F. Scott Fitzgerald was born in St. Paul, Minnesota, in 1896. He attended Princeton University, joined the United States Army during World War I, and published his first novel, This Side of Paradise, in 1920. That same year he married Zelda Sayre and for the next decade the couple lived in New York, Paris, and on the Riviera. Fitzgerald’s masterpieces include The Beautiful and Damned, The Great Gatsby, and Tender Is the Night. He died at the age of forty-four while working on The Last Tycoon. Fitzgerald’s fiction has secured his reputation as one of the most important American writers of the twentieth century.

- Rating: 1 out of 5 stars1/5This audiobook contains the worst narration I've ever heard. I listened to about half of the story. During that time, Michael Venditti mispronounced dozens of words. There is no rhythm in his narration. His sudden starts and stops are jarring. I tried to finish this version of The Curious Case of Benjamin Button, but I wasn't able to. I switched to the version narrated by B.J. Harrison, which I enjoyed much more.
